Our client, a well-established and highly regarded civil engineering contractor, is looking to appoint a Bid Manager to support a growing pipeline of work across Scotland and the North East of England, largely driven by major energy and infrastructure projects. This opportunity is open to candidates from a range of backgrounds. Whether you are an experienced Bid Manager or a Senior Bid Writer looking to step up, this role offers the chance to take greater ownership of the bid function and play a key role in securing future work — overseeing the full submissions process, contributing to bid strategy, and supporting the development of a small team of bid writers.

The Role:

  • Help to lead and manage the end-to-end bid process, from initial enquiry through to submission
  • Take overall responsibility for the quality and delivery of submissions
  • Work collaboratively with internal teams, including commercial, operational, and technical departments
  • Coordinate input from across the business to develop compelling, compliant bids
  • Oversee and support a small team of bid writers
  • Liaise with clients to clarify requirements and strengthen pre-construction relationships
  • Contribute to continuous improvement and post-tender reviews

Projects Include:

  • Windfarms
  • Battery storage facilities
  • Flood and coastal protection
  • Substation works
  • General civil engineering and infrastructure projects
